Chicken Parmesan Meatballs

Ingredients

  1. 1 pound ground chicken

  2. 3/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ese (Schnucks)

  3. 3 tablespoons yellow cornmeal

  4. 2 tablespoons Extra virgin olive oil

  5. garlic cloves (crushed with press)

  6. 1 tablespoon Italian seasoning.

  1. 1 teaspoon salt.

  1. 1 teaspoon ground black pepper

  1. nonstick cooking spray

INSTRUCTIONS

  1. In large bowl, gently mix all ingredients except cooking spray until well combined. Cover with plastic wrap; refrigerate 30 minutes.

  2. Preheat oven to 400°F. Line rimmed baking pan with aluminum foil; spray with cooking spray. Form chicken mixture into 1½" meatballs; place 1" apart on prepared pan. Bake 15 to 17 minutes or until lightly browned and internal temperature reaches 165°F. Makes about 12 meatballs.
